Hotel Turnerwirt - Salzburg
47.81593, 13.07011Located a 10-minute drive from Fortress Hohensalzburg, the 3-star Hotel Turnerwirt Salzburg is directly on the outskirts of Salzburg and 1.8 miles from Plaza de Mozart. This family-run hotel comes with Wi-Fi in public areas.
Location
The hotel is situated in the Gnigl district, near bars and restaurants. Guests can get to Salzburg city center, which is 0.9 miles away. 1.7 miles from Mirabell Palace is a perk for guests staying at this romantic property.
Turnerstrasse bus stop is a 5-minute stroll from Hotel Turnerwirt and 1.9 miles from is enough to get to Salzburg Central train station.
Rooms
Some rooms are decorated in modern design. Bathroom amenities include a bathtub, a separate toilet, and a shower, along with comforts such as hair dryers and towels.
Eat & Drink
This Salzburg hotel invites guests to the lounge bar to relax with a drink. Tandoori Pizza City offers a selection of dishes 500 feet away.
